Update mdp5_pipe to incorporate SSPP_NONE and SSPP_CURSORx
pipes

Signed-off-by: Archit Taneja <architt at codeaurora.org>
---
 rnndb/mdp/mdp5.xml | 25 ++++++++++++++-----------
 1 file changed, 14 insertions(+), 11 deletions(-)

diff --git a/rnndb/mdp/mdp5.xml b/rnndb/mdp/mdp5.xml
index 49aa207..a5ae1e3 100644
--- a/rnndb/mdp/mdp5.xml
+++ b/rnndb/mdp/mdp5.xml
@@ -47,16 +47,19 @@ xsi:schemaLocation="http://nouveau.freedesktop.org/ 
rules-ng.xsd">
        </enum>

        <enum name="mdp5_pipe">
-               <value name="SSPP_VIG0" value="0"/>
-               <value name="SSPP_VIG1" value="1"/>
-               <value name="SSPP_VIG2" value="2"/>
-               <value name="SSPP_RGB0" value="3"/>
-               <value name="SSPP_RGB1" value="4"/>
-               <value name="SSPP_RGB2" value="5"/>
-               <value name="SSPP_DMA0" value="6"/>
-               <value name="SSPP_DMA1" value="7"/>
-               <value name="SSPP_VIG3" value="8"/>
-               <value name="SSPP_RGB3" value="9"/>
+               <value name="SSPP_NONE" value="0"/>
+               <value name="SSPP_VIG0" value="1"/>
+               <value name="SSPP_VIG1" value="2"/>
+               <value name="SSPP_VIG2" value="3"/>
+               <value name="SSPP_RGB0" value="4"/>
+               <value name="SSPP_RGB1" value="5"/>
+               <value name="SSPP_RGB2" value="6"/>
+               <value name="SSPP_DMA0" value="7"/>
+               <value name="SSPP_DMA1" value="8"/>
+               <value name="SSPP_VIG3" value="9"/>
+               <value name="SSPP_RGB3" value="10"/>
+               <value name="SSPP_CURSOR0" value="11"/>
+               <value name="SSPP_CURSOR1" value="12"/>
        </enum>

        <enum name="mdp5_format">
@@ -291,7 +294,7 @@ xsi:schemaLocation="http://nouveau.freedesktop.org/ 
rules-ng.xsd">
                <value name="DATA_FORMAT_YUV" value="1"/>
        </enum>

-       <array 
doffsets="mdp5_cfg->pipe_vig.base[0],mdp5_cfg->pipe_vig.base[1],mdp5_cfg->pipe_vig.base[2],mdp5_cfg->pipe_rgb.base[0],mdp5_cfg->pipe_rgb.base[1],mdp5_cfg->pipe_rgb.base[2],mdp5_cfg->pipe_dma.base[0],mdp5_cfg->pipe_dma.base[1],mdp5_cfg->pipe_vig.base[3],mdp5_cfg->pipe_rgb.base[3]"
 name="PIPE" length="10" stride="0x400" index="mdp5_pipe">
+       <array 
doffsets="INVALID_IDX(idx),mdp5_cfg->pipe_vig.base[0],mdp5_cfg->pipe_vig.base[1],mdp5_cfg->pipe_vig.base[2],mdp5_cfg->pipe_rgb.base[0],mdp5_cfg->pipe_rgb.base[1],mdp5_cfg->pipe_rgb.base[2],mdp5_cfg->pipe_dma.base[0],mdp5_cfg->pipe_dma.base[1],mdp5_cfg->pipe_vig.base[3],mdp5_cfg->pipe_rgb.base[3],mdp5_cfg->pipe_cursor.base[0],mdp5_cfg->pipe_cursor.base[1]"
 name="PIPE" length="10" stride="0x400" index="mdp5_pipe">
                <reg32 offset="0x200" name="OP_MODE">
                        <bitfield name="CSC_DST_DATA_FORMAT" pos="19" 
type="mdp5_data_format"/>
                        <bitfield name="CSC_SRC_DATA_FORMAT" pos="18" 
type="mdp5_data_format"/>
-- 
The Qualcomm Innovation Center, Inc. is a member of the Code Aurora Forum,
hosted by The Linux Foundation

Reply via email to